High Incarceration Rate of Albanian Men in England and Wales

Official data suggests that around 1 in 36 Albanian men in England and Wales are in jail, a rate significantly higher than that of British-born men. This is linked to the rise of Albanian organized crime groups involved in drug trafficking and other serious crimes.

Greece Streamlines Tax Registration to Attract Foreign Residents

Greece is simplifying its tax registration process to attract wealthy individuals, retirees, and workers, aiming to finalize applications in days instead of months. Polish Heritage Flourishes in German Literature

The number of German authors with Polish roots is rising, with many achieving success in prestigious literary awards, such as the Ingeborg Bachmann Prize, and publishing houses, showcasing their bicultural heritage and experiences.

Brandenburg Jusos Reject Stricter Migration Policies

Brandenburg's Jusos reject Union and SPD's stricter migration plans, criticizing border rejections as violating fundamental rights and opposing citizenship revocations deemed unconstitutional, potentially creating friction within the governing coalition.
